Macy's (NYSE:M) Stock, Dividends

Macy's issues dividends to shareholders from excess cash Macy's generates. Most companies pay dividends on a quarterly basis, but dividends may also be paid monthly, annually or at irregular intervals.

Macy's Inc Dividend Overview

Macy's Inc currently pays a quarterly dividend of $0.69 per year for a yield of 4.53%.

Macy's Inc last traded ex-dividend on Sep 13 and the next ex-dividend date is unknown.
